The Donetsk court granted the tax authority's claim against Vitaliy Shabunin to recover 126,000 hryvnias of debt. The court found no evidence of the activist's participation in hostilities.

The shadow economy in Ukraine reaches 50% of the market, which leads to budget losses of 800-900 billion hryvnias. The most profitable sectors are tobacco, alcohol, gadgets, the agricultural sector and the gambling business.

In Kryvyi Rih, the BEB discovered a plant that illegally produced over 100 tons of gasoline and diesel fuel every day. The fuel was sold through a network of gas stations using forged documents.
